The tariff classification of footwear from China
Issued June 8, 1999 by U.S. Customs and Border Protection.
Tariff classification
HTS codes: 6403.91.90
Headings: 6403
Product description
The submitted half pair sample, identified by you as a “Stacked Heel Boot”, is a woman’s over-the-ankle fashion boot, with an approximately 8 inch high suede leather upper that features a side zipper closure and a 2 inch high stacked plastic heel. The boot is textile lined and has a rubber/plastic outer sole.
CBP rationale
The applicable subheading for this woman’s boot will be 6403.91.90,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for footwear, with uppers predominately of leather and outer soles of rubber, plastics, or composition leather; which is not “sports footwear”; which covers the ankle; and which is for women, misses, children or infants.

The rate of duty will be 10% ad valorem. We are returning the sample as you requested.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177). A copy of the ruling or the control number indicated above should be provided with the entry documents filed at the time this merchandise is imported.
